In the search for interesting culinary or drinking experiences in this great city, there always needs to be some expectation management, as experiences may vary. However, once in awhile you find places that are consistently excellent.   One of those is the bar Cantina, which is located near Union Square and offers a cozy yet vibrant environment where the only thing muffling the sounds of the very active bartenders is the house D.J., who spins an ecclectic set of music.

As for the drinks, Cantina offers “specifically handcrafted culinary cocktails, wines from Latin appellations, and locally brewed beers.”  Working with premium spirits, homemade bitters, syrups, infusions, classic seltzer and the all-important hand squeezed citrus, the talented barmen and women of Cantina shake exquisite hand made cocktails such as a top notch Pisco Sour or one of their “Cocktails de Culinaire” such as the “Milk of Millenia’’, which lists its ingredients as sagatiba cachaça pura, VeeV açai distillate, muddled mint & ginger, lemon, agave nectar, and ginseng drizzle. 

This is a great place to star or finish your evening.  The only requirement is a little patience, since these are not mass-produced drinks, but handcrafted culinary cocktails.  Enjoy.
